Pros

Good product with top notch manufacturing facilities

Cons

There is zero trust for any external sales employee. If you are to join the company in an external sales role in GB expect to be micro managed to within an inch of your life…no exaggeration. Huge level of staff turnover on external roles and that is the reason why. They have made it compulsory for external sales staff to be office based 2 days a week. On these days you are required to log and send the number of phone calls you have made, number of meetings you have booked (despite management have the IT resources to see this automatically for themselves) Despite various attempts made by HR and Marketing to improve things, the company culture is just vile. Again, all links back to the complete lack of trust staff are given. Don’t expect to have any input (not even a quick conversation with management) into the budget/target for the year. Do not expect a culture where you can positively or confidently challenge decisions made higher up…huge bullseye on your back if you do. The business seems very detached from the reality of the market. They have no interest in building “real” relationships with its customers. They want to be more “transactional” with their customers, hence the huge shift in “external” sales staff actually being internally based at Tobermore HQ There is almost zero chance of any career progression either…this seems reserved for staff close to the Senior Management Team.

Pros

Good for an introduction to Sales/Construction Sales. But I wouldn't recommend this company for more than a year or so to get your experience, then get out.

Cons

Tobermore have fully signed up to Dynamite Lifestyle - which is a Law of Manifestation cult/pyramid scheme. Expect to be pushed to post on their platform (and be assessed for it), expect to be encouraged to 'read books' on it, expect meditation sessions, etc. This is not a joke, and all these examples were things that we pushed on the team without our say-so. We were told after it being introduced: "If you don't like it, leave the company". Take that for what you will. For Sales, they have introduced a dynamic salary: if you do 'X' Sales in 2021/22 you get 'X' Salary. If you do higher, you get more. If you do lesser, you get less. There isn't a flat Salary any more, it's completely variable on your performance. Flat hierarchical structure - few opportunities to promote. Baffling senior leadership strategy - jobs will be advertised internally in January, then pulled out in March because 'we have changed our outlook'. Lots of micromanagement - I was in Specification Sales and they monitor your calls, output, diary (and if it's not colour-coded, woe betide you!), they will with-hold bonuses (even if you've hit your Sales Figures) because you might not have done the mandated 10 calls a day. Pros

Nothing positive to share on company

Cons

Toxic work place culture that is controlled by husband and wife team at the top. No trust in the wider workforce with network of “spies” to weed out those that aren’t to their exact specifications. Everything is presented as world class but it’s anything but. Staff turnover is high (apart from anyone who is actually from Tobermore itself). Don’t expect your career to progress here
